I'd highly advise getting a commander that helps newbies. I started my first month solo just to learn the ins and outs, but I would be a little farther ahead if I had picked up a commander from the beginning.

When you get a commander, they get a slight unit production bonus based on how much of their income they pass to their officers. In turn, you get up to 30% of the commander's income divided by how many officers they have. This extra naq would be a good help to starter players as it would allow you to increase your UP greatly over what you could do without it.

Without a commander, you get a 10% naq + 10% unit production bonus, or you can make yourself your own commander and get a 20% unit production bonus. This is usually what most of the bigger players do, but newer, smaller players would benefit greatly by having a commander as their unit production isn't very high anyway.
